รายละเอียดของการตอบ ::
1. ความสำคัญของคีย์หลัก คือ เป็นตัวแทนของแถว
เป็นสิ่งที่ใช้ในการเชื่อมโยงกับตารางอื่น
ดังนั้นจึงไม่นิยม สร้างคีย์หลักที่เป็นลักษณะ Compound คือประกอบด้วยหลายคอลัมภ์
เพราะเขียนโปรแกรมผิดพลาดได้ง่าย สับสน
เวลาเขียน SQL เชื่อมตารางกันก็ลำบาก
2. การเก็บข้อมูลในเพจ (ฮาร์ดดิส) จะถูกจัดเรียงตามคีย์หลัก
ดังนั้นหากลำดับการบันทึกของข้อมูล ไม่สอดคล้องกับลำดับการเรียงของคีย์หลัก
การบันทึกข้อมูลก็จะช้ากว่า เพราะ Engine ต้องเสียเวลาส่วนหนึ่งในการจัดเรียงข้อมูลใหม่
3.....
ให้เติมเอง